My Wedding by Hitched

If you want step-by-step guidance, this is the app for you! This handy tool covers everything from to do lists to budgets, seating arrangement and guests list, so you won’t miss a beat. It even comes with pre-prepared tasks which chronologically sync up to your wedding date so you won’t forget to advise your venue on your final numbers, or even pack your overnight case. The app also allows you the flexibility to delete and add your own reminders as not everything may apply to you. The budgeting section is a firm favourite with users and it’s not hard to see why! Simply add your budget and the app breaks it down for you, suggesting how much you should allocate to each element. Clever!

Postable

Save yourself the hassle of contacting friends and family members for their postal addresses with this nippy little tool. All you need to do is set up a free account and create an online address book which allows your family and friends to fill in their details. You can then export all the data and print out your address labels, making your invite woes a worry free!

Appy Couple

Although it isn’t free, if you’re serious about wedding planning, this is the app for you! If you need to inform your guests of details on accommodation, travel, directions and menus, Appy Couple allows you to create your very own wedding website and app to display all your wedding details. Guests can even RSVP and upload photos from your big day so they’re all in one handy place.

The Knot look book

With a whole world of wedding dresses out there, sometimes it can be hard to know where to start! Thankfully, there’s an app for that! The Knot’s highly rated app lets you scroll through almost 10,000 of the season’s wedding dresses, affording you the option to filter by designer, cut, fabric and budget. While it’s an American app, the ‘Find a store’ option doesn’t work so well if you’re shopping in the UK or Ireland, but it still gives you a chance to browse online and find a style you like.

Top Table Planner

Ask any couple what gave them the biggest headache in wedding planning, and you’re sure to be met with: “Table plans!” Not anymore! This handy app allows you to choose your table type and number of seats so that you can import your guest list and drag, drop and rearrange until your heart is content! Easy.
